Wonderful Water June Day 4

First, we took turns with Archery and then we played a team building game called "Crossing the River". After our first hike, we recorded the results from our water pollution experiment. We concluded that polluted water decreases the capillary uptake of plants. Then we performed "Hummingbirds and the Selfish Fox". Then we discussed colored lakes. We talked about why Lake Natron and others have strange colors (mostly due to minerals and bacteria). After that, we made a Solar Still in the ground to collect fresh water to drink. There won't be any water until tomorrow. After snack, we did Suminagashi painting (floating ink painting). Then we went to visit the new guinea hen chicks on our way to the shoals part of the creek again. We also picked and ate blueberries and blackberries.
